Asheville, NC is considered more of an urban area with elements of both suburban and rural characteristics. The city itself is quite dense, with a population of around 92,000 residents. While it has a lively downtown with numerous shops, restaurants, and cultural venues, Asheville still retains a relaxed and friendly atmosphere.

In terms of landscape, Asheville and its surrounding areas are known for their natural beauty. The city is nestled in the Blue Ridge Mountains, providing stunning views and ample opportunities for outdoor activities, such as hiking, biking, and fishing. Additionally, Asheville is home to the famous Biltmore Estate, a grand mansion surrounded by expansive gardens and picturesque scenery.

Asheville offers a range of amenities to residents and visitors. There are several shopping centers and malls, including the Asheville Mall and Biltmore Park Town Square, which feature a variety of retail stores, dining options, and entertainment venues. The city also hosts various festivals, art exhibits, and live music performances throughout the year.

When it comes to churches, Asheville is home to a diverse range of religious affiliations. There are numerous Christian churches, including denominations such as Baptist, Methodist, Presbyterian, and Catholic, among others. Additionally, there are also non-Christian places of worship, including synagogues, mosques, and Buddhist centers.

As for healthcare facilities, Asheville has a number of hospitals and healthcare centers that serve the area. The main medical facility is Mission Hospital, which is the largest hospital in western North Carolina and offers a wide range of medical services. There are also several smaller hospitals and clinics, such as Park Ridge Health and St. Joseph's Hospital, providing healthcare options for residents.

Furthermore, Asheville is known for its alternative and holistic healthcare options, with numerous practitioners specializing in areas like naturopathy, acupuncture, and chiropractic care.

Overall, Asheville, NC is a vibrant urban area with a mix of suburban and rural characteristics. It offers residents and visitors a beautiful natural setting, numerous amenities, a variety of churches, and a solid healthcare infrastructure.
